在电脑使用过程中,我们经常会遇到内存不足的情况,导致系统运行缓慢或者出现崩溃。为了更好地了解和掌握电脑内存的使用情况,我们可以利用“show memory”命令来排查系统运行状况。本文将详细介绍“show memory”命令的用法及其在排查内存问题中的应用。
什么是“show memory”命令?
“show memory”命令是一种在Linux系统中用于显示内存使用情况的命令。通过执行该命令,我们可以了解当前系统的内存使用情况,包括总内存、已使用内存、空闲内存、交换空间等信息。
如何使用“show memory”命令?
在Linux系统中,打开终端并输入以下命令:
show memory
执行该命令后,系统会显示内存使用情况的详细信息。以下是一些常用的参数:
-h:以可读的格式显示内存大小。-b:以字节为单位显示内存大小。-k:以千字节为单位显示内存大小。-m:以兆字节为单位显示内存大小。
例如,要使用可读的格式显示内存大小,可以使用以下命令:
show memory -h
“show memory”命令的输出内容解析
执行“show memory”命令后,输出内容主要包括以下几部分:
- Memory: 显示总内存大小、已使用内存、空闲内存、交换空间等信息。
- Swap: 显示交换空间的总大小、已使用大小、空闲大小等信息。
- Cache: 显示缓存的大小,用于提高系统性能。
以下是一个示例输出:
Memory: 8192MB total, 6400MB used, 1792MB free
Swap: 2048MB total, 0MB used, 2048MB free
Cache: 256MB
从输出内容中,我们可以看出当前系统的内存使用情况。例如,如果已使用内存接近总内存,那么可能存在内存不足的问题。
“show memory”命令在排查内存问题中的应用
- 判断内存是否充足:通过观察已使用内存与总内存的比例,可以初步判断内存是否充足。如果比例过高,可能需要增加内存或优化内存使用。
- 分析内存使用情况:通过分析内存使用情况,可以找出占用内存较多的进程或程序,从而针对性地解决问题。
- 监控内存变化:定期执行“show memory”命令,可以监控内存使用情况的变化,及时发现并解决内存问题。
总结
掌握“show memory”命令,可以帮助我们更好地了解和掌握电脑内存的使用情况,从而在遇到内存问题时能够迅速定位并解决问题。希望本文能帮助您更好地利用这一命令,提高电脑使用体验。